计算化学公社

标题: 高斯在windows下的效率比Linux差多少? [打印本页]

作者
Author:
wrtgcn    时间: 2019-10-12 00:50
标题: 高斯在windows下的效率比Linux差多少?
在外访学,看个隔壁组有个小哥在windows下用高斯跑上百个原子的polymer。问他为啥不在Linux下计算,说是因为他们只有windows版本。突然有点好奇,在windows下高斯计算的效率会比Linux下差多少?

作者
Author:
bobosiji    时间: 2019-10-12 09:49
差很多,还有运行稳定性问题等。gaussian linux版又不贵。。。
作者
Author:
snljty    时间: 2019-10-12 10:37
1400 MB的内存上限大任务还是很捉鸡
作者
Author:
sobereva    时间: 2019-10-12 10:44
普通泛函算小体系不会有差别,算稍微大些的体系,或者哪怕对中小体系做后HF方法计算,不用linux版是不可能的,即便有Windows 64bit版Gaussian也没用
作者
Author:
wrtgcn    时间: 2019-10-12 11:43
sobereva 发表于 2019-10-12 10:44
普通泛函算小体系不会有差别,算稍微大些的体系,或者哪怕对中小体系做后HF方法计算,不用linux版是不可能 ...

大致聊了几句,好像说是在测试方法还是什么的。用的是Gaussian 16,不知道是32还是64bit版,就在他座位上一个挺大的主机上跑。这么大的体系用高斯,还是在windows下计算,当时我感觉挺新奇的。
作者
Author:
sobereva    时间: 2019-10-13 13:59
wrtgcn 发表于 2019-10-12 11:43
大致聊了几句,好像说是在测试方法还是什么的。用的是Gaussian 16,不知道是32还是64bit版,就在他座位上 ...

预感他浪费了大量计算资源
作者
Author:
liyuanhe211    时间: 2019-10-14 02:52
sobereva 发表于 2019-10-12 10:44
普通泛函算小体系不会有差别,算稍微大些的体系,或者哪怕对中小体系做后HF方法计算,不用linux版是不可能 ...

诶?为什么Win 64bit也不行?
作者
Author:
wrtgcn    时间: 2019-10-15 00:48
sobereva 发表于 2019-10-13 13:59
预感他浪费了大量计算资源

他后来给我看了输入文件。用的apfd和6-31+G(d, p),140+原子个数的polymer,但是又只调用了4GB内存。据说一算就是两三周,并认为加大内存并不会增加计算速度。在我的印象里,主机上跑高斯一般是核数限制任务数,内存很少不够。如果不需要占用很多计算资源,是不是Win和Linux下的效率差不多啊。
作者
Author:
sobereva    时间: 2019-10-15 01:04
liyuanhe211 发表于 2019-10-14 02:52
诶?为什么Win 64bit也不行?

我用2*2696v3在Win10系统下测试过win64的Gaussian,即便是纯CPU运算的任务,速度也远远慢于Linux版,完全发挥不出CPU实际运算能力(虽然也不排除是系统、软件兼容性方面的可能)
作者
Author:
sobereva    时间: 2019-10-15 01:06
wrtgcn 发表于 2019-10-15 00:48
他后来给我看了输入文件。用的apfd和6-31+G(d, p),140+原子个数的polymer,但是又只调用了4GB内存。据说 ...

内存大小对纯泛函的单点、优化计算速度完全没影响
光从用APFD这一点,我就感觉这人水平欠佳
如果是核数较多的服务器,用Windows版完全发挥不出性能
作者
Author:
wrtgcn    时间: 2019-10-15 01:12
sobereva 发表于 2019-10-15 01:06
内存大小对纯泛函的单点、优化计算速度完全没影响
光从用APFD这一点,我就感觉这人水平欠佳
如果是核数 ...

好的,谢谢社长~
作者
Author:
zhaoyangwx    时间: 2020-4-16 21:19
可以对比一下直接跑Windows版高斯和用WSL在Windows上跑Linux版高斯,看看效率差异是系统的原因还是软件编译的原因。
作者
Author:
一颗赛艇    时间: 2020-4-17 14:57
wrtgcn 发表于 2019-10-15 00:48
他后来给我看了输入文件。用的apfd和6-31+G(d, p),140+原子个数的polymer,但是又只调用了4GB内存。据说 ...

感觉这明显是被新版《explore》带坑里的计算文盲
作者
Author:
Q-Chembio-llg    时间: 2020-4-18 12:16
snljty 发表于 2019-10-12 10:37
1400 MB的内存上限大任务还是很捉鸡

请问是不是说win版的高斯即使在gif文件中写了%mem=10GB也只能发挥出1400MB呢?
作者
Author:
snljty    时间: 2020-4-18 14:09
Q-Chembio-llg 发表于 2020-4-18 12:16
请问是不是说win版的高斯即使在gif文件中写了%mem=10GB也只能发挥出1400MB呢?

好像64位版本没这个限制
作者
Author:
Q-Chembio-llg    时间: 2020-4-18 15:34
snljty 发表于 2020-4-18 14:09
好像64位版本没这个限制

哦哦好的谢谢您




欢迎光临 计算化学公社 (http://bbs.keinsci.com/) Powered by Discuz! X3.3